Seems to me that Douglas and Patrick have far too many possessions. When I was young, I moved my family several times with just a car and a borrowed truck. And that was in one day. Of course, we didn't have much in those days and it might take a bit longer if we were to attempt it today. But still, I think these two need to have a yard sale before they move next time.

That's my reaction to the piece and it may be true that others have many more things to transport. But the matter has some bearing on the tale as well. All this toing and froing does not make the most interesting or gripping reading. The constant decision to do a bit more the next day becomes tedious, especially as virtually nothing unusual happens in the course of each day's events. Only the weather provides a little relief by raining sometimes.

That is the main problem with the story, that very little happens beyond going in between the old house and the new. But not enough is explained of the setting. As an example, consider the first paragraph. What is this about a guard post? It's never explained. And who or what is released by the pressing of the button? Complete mystery.

What the story needs is less concentration on how many journeys were made and instead a compression of it all into fewer trips but more accidents, more things going wrong, more humour in other words. Moving is a traumatic experience, even if you're trying to write in the meantime. Make it an adventure that repays the hard work with memories to look back on.

And my advice is to avoid the present tense. It should only be used if there's a very good reason for it. I heartily approve of the font used however. Makes for a very easy read.
